Key Molecules
4-Hydroxynonenal (4-HNE)
- Primary toxic aldehyde from linoleic acid oxidation
- Bifunctional electrophile — forms covalent adducts with proteins, DNA, lipids
- Specifically inhibits: prolyl hydroxylase, lysyl oxidase, Complex I/II (mitochondria), MERTK/AXL (efferocytosis), autophagy machinery
- Genotoxic and cytotoxic at concentrations found in end-of-life fryer oil
- Modifies histone proteins → epigenetic programming
- → See [[Lipid Oxidation Chemistry]]
OXLAMs (Oxidized Linoleic Acid Metabolites)
- 9-HODE, 13-HODE, 9-oxoODE, 13-oxoODE
- Direct TLR4 agonists — same receptor as LPS
- Activate mast cells through CD36 and TLR4
- Accumulate in adipose tissue as reservoir
- → See [[Lipid Oxidation Chemistry]]
Total Polar Compounds (TPC)
- The aggregate non-volatile toxic burden
- Cannot be reduced by deodorization
- The only fraud-resistant quality measure
- European standard: 25–27% maximum
- US: no standard exists
- → See [[TPC Standards]]
